Storage Tips for Lake Oswego Vehicle Owners

Verify Vehicle Capacity

Confirm your vehicle dimensions against the storage space dimensions. A 10x30 unit may not fit your vehicle if the door opening is narrower than the unit interior.

Document the Facility Agreement

Keep a copy of your kayak, canoe, and paddleboard storage contract, insurance policy, and facility contact information in a safe place. You will need these if you file a claim or dispute.

Plan Your Exit Strategy

Know the notice period required to end your kayak, canoe, and paddleboard storage contract. Most facilities require 30 days notice. Leaving without proper notice can result in forfeited deposits.
